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30452 21196116 8897 3463449
9985927995 55397661
9985927995 55397661
19584520 9085134852 017355352
All about undefined
Interested in learning more?
9985927995 55397661
19584520 9085134852 017355352
See more
96334 3847753 1032632509
19 41638807 97075
See more
0625505948 449 194849
55 21672126598 7600566
See more